Compare all specifications:
1981 Fiat 131 | 1969 Ford Capri | |
Make | Fiat | Ford |
Model | 131 | Capri |
Year Released | 1981 | 1969 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1995 cc | 1298 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 111 HP | 63 HP |
Engine RPM | 5600 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1105 kg | 915 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4270 mm | 4270 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1660 mm | 1650 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1400 mm | 1300 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2500 mm | 2570 mm |
